
The venue, Three Haus, will be located inside a traditional Austrian tavern, Berghof Garden, and has secured Kentish Town collective DiscoFunk as resident DJs throughout the week.
The line-up also includes The Cuban Brothers, Maxxi Soundsystem and Kiss FM DJs Rickie and Melvin, who will spin old school tunes in a 'Kiss Story' set on the festival’s closing night. Attendees can also expect a number of surprise guests.
The brand will be looking to promote its service to festival-goers, which allows customers make calls, texts and use their data in 19 countries, including Austria, without roaming charges.
Besides its own experiential activity, the brand will also sponsor the Forest Parties held on the final nights of the festival, which will be headlined by The Prodigy.
Combining winter sports and aprés ski parties, Snowbombing is the biggest festival of its kind in Europe.
Pippa Whybourne, lead communications manager at Three, said: "At Three, we’re all about using your phone abroad at no extra cost to make our customers feel at home. We are therefore looking forward to welcoming Snowbombers to ‘our haus’ so they can share their party pictures shamelessly."
Festival organiser Broadwick Live confirmed Three as Snowbombing's technology and communications partner .
